## Why You Need a Structured Strands Practice Routine
If you are new to NYT Strands, diving directly into challenging daily boards can feel overwhelming. Unlike Wordle, which offers strict color feedback, Strands provides a blank 48-letter grid with only a short clue.
This **7-Day Practice Plan** is designed specifically for beginners. Each day isolates one core skill so you can systematically build confidence, improve board awareness, and achieve your first hint-free win by Day 7.

### Day 1: Master Non-Theme Word Hunting (Building Your Safety Net)
* **Goal:** Learn how the hint engine works and build confidence selecting words.
* **Exercise:** Open a board on [Strands Unlimited](https://strandsgames.org/strands-unlimited). Before looking for any theme words, deliberately find **6 non-theme words** of 4 or more letters (e.g., *STAR*, *RATE*, *LINE*, *HOLD*).
* **Key Takeaway:** You now have 2 full Hint Tokens banked. Knowing you have hints available removes solving anxiety.
---
### Day 2: Corner and Edge Node Recognition
* **Goal:** Eliminate low-mobility letter tiles before they trap you.
* **Exercise:** Inspect only the 4 corners and the 24 perimeter edge tiles on the board.
* **Key Takeaway:** Corner letters have only 3 neighbors. If you see an *X, Z, Q,* or *V* in a corner, trace its only possible connecting letters first.
---
### Day 3: Clue Deconstruction & Brainstorming
* **Goal:** Decode subtle or punny NYT theme clues before touching the board.
* **Exercise:** Read the theme clue. Before touching a single letter tile, write down **8 words** associated with that subject.
* **Example:** If the clue is *"Breakfast Spread"*, immediately write down: *BUTTER, JAM, JELLY, TOAST, MARMALADE, HONEY, BAGEL, CREAM*.
* **Key Takeaway:** Looking for pre-visualized words on the board is 3x faster than searching blindly.
---
### Day 4: Spangram Tracing & Opposite Edge Bridging
* **Goal:** Learn to identify and connect the board-spanning word.
* **Exercise:** Search specifically for the word that connects two opposing sides (*Left to Right* or *Top to Bottom*).

### Day 5: Untangling Overlapping Letter Strands
* **Goal:** Avoid "stealing" letters required by neighboring theme words.
* **Exercise:** When you find a theme word, pause before submitting. Check whether the remaining adjacent letters can still form valid words or if you leave an isolated, unusable single letter (*orphan tile*).
* **Key Takeaway:** Every letter on the 48-letter grid must be used. If your word leaves an isolated consonant with no vowels, you may have used the wrong path.
---
### Day 6: The Hint-Free Official Challenge
* **Goal:** Complete a full daily puzzle without tapping the hint button.
* **Exercise:** Play today's official puzzle on the [Strands Game Homepage](https://strandsgames.org/). Follow the exact sequence:
1. Brainstorm clue words (30 seconds).
2. Scan corners & outer edges.
3. Find and lock the Spangram.
4. Clear remaining letter clusters quadrant by quadrant.

## Daily Practice Checklist
Keep this quick checklist handy each time you sit down to play:
* [ ] Read clue and brainstorm 5-8 related words.
* [ ] Check all 4 corners for rare letters.
* [ ] Identify whether Spangram runs horizontally or vertically.
* [ ] Verify that submitted words do not leave orphan tiles.
